
Rafael Termes
Rafael Termes was a notable Spanish businessman and banker, remembered for his influential role in the financial sector during the late 20th century. His contributions to banking and finance are often contrasted with contemporary figures in the industry, reflecting on the changes in economic practices and corporate governance.
